We released the 2.0.0-alpha1 version for ASP.NET Identity. Learn more here http://blogs.msdn.com/b/webdev/archive/2013/12/20/announcing-preview-of-microsoft-aspnet-identity-2-0-0-alpha1.aspx One of the features in this version is Account Confirmation and Password Reset. As part of this new feature we have added two new properties to the IdentityUser class namely ‘Email’ and ‘IsConfirmed’. This results in a change of the schema created by the ASP.NET Identity system in 2.0. Updating the package in an existing application (which was using 1.0) will cause the application to fail since the Entity Framework model has been changed.
